The Importance of Downpipe Gully Covers in Urban Drainage Systems
In urban environments, effective stormwater management is crucial to preventing flooding and maintaining the integrity of infrastructure. One of the key components in this system is the downpipe gully cover. While often overlooked, these covers play a vital role in ensuring that rainwater is channeled efficiently from rooftops to the drainage network below.
Downpipes are vertical pipes installed to collect rainwater from gutters, directing it down from roofs and into the underground drainage system. However, without effective gully covers, these systems can become overwhelmed or obstructed. A gully cover acts as a protective barrier, preventing debris such as leaves, dirt, and litter from entering the drainage system. This debris can lead to blockages, resulting in overflows during heavy rainstorms and potentially causing flooding in low-lying areas.
Another critical function of downpipe gully covers is safety. When heavy rains occur, the flow of water can obscure visibility and create hazardous conditions. Gully covers are designed to provide a stable surface, reducing the risk of accidents for pedestrians and vehicles. Properly installed gully covers can also prevent animals and small children from falling into open drainage systems, contributing to community safety.
Furthermore, downpipe gully covers contribute to the longevity of the drainage infrastructure. The accumulation of debris can lead to corrosion and deterioration of the pipes and drains over time. By acting as the first line of defense, these covers help protect the drainage system's integrity, reducing maintenance costs and extending the lifespan of the infrastructure.
From an aesthetic standpoint, gully covers can also enhance the appearance of public spaces. Available in various designs and materials, they can be integrated into the urban landscape, providing a cohesive look while fulfilling their practical functions. Several municipalities have even employed innovative designs that incorporate decorative elements, making them not only functional but visually appealing.
In recent years, environmental concerns have also been linked to stormwater management systems. Urban runoff can carry pollutants into natural water bodies, affecting ecosystems and water quality. Downpipe gully covers can be complemented with filters or sediment traps that enhance their performance by capturing pollutants before they enter the drainage system. This approach not only mitigates flooding risks but also supports environmental sustainability.
